Glyn Johns documented the “Get Back” sessions primed The Beatles in January 1969.

It was funny actually. I got a phone call from individual with a Liverpudlian voice explode I thought it was Mick Jagger taking the piss. Degree, it was Paul McCartney. Gift you don’t turn down Thankless McCartney. The idea was location like [Bob Dylan and Greatness Band’s] The Basement Tapes, make somebody's day show what they were in point of fact like. I’d worked with earth and their mother by corroboration, so I was quite cast-off to being around people who were famous. But when Unrestrained got the call, to move in and be privy give confidence those guys sitting around, familiarity what they did, and apply to be invited in, was appealing astonishing. I didn’t know them. I was the same laugh every other punter on greatness planet, who saw them orang-utan these extraordinary icons of marvellousness.

And although they could little be normal people, because commemorate what their success had completed to them, I was witnessing them being normal to wad other. Which no one differently had got to see, pivotal which nobody really had systematic clue about. And so blurry concept of the record was: how fantastic to have marvellous record of them playing be real, sitting around mocking each assail, just having a laugh. Right was very weird. But Martyr Martin, being the gentleman think it over he is, he realised stroll I had been compromised deliver a way, and he aphorism fit to put me concede defeat ease about the situation. Be active took me to lunch, increase in intensity he said, “You’re not cause somebody to worry about a thing.” Uproarious was feeling really awkward distinguish the whole thing, and no problem was completely at ease progress the situation.Because he is undeniable of his own abilities.

Glyn Artist – From “And In Greatness End” by Ken McNab, attend to quoted in Classic Rock, Possibly will 2020

In March 1969, he was then asked by Paul Songwriter and John Lennon to fabricate an LP from those sessions.

On the 1st of May 1969 [Sic – March instead ?], I got a call outlander John and Paul asking simulation to meet them at Convent Road. I walked into say publicly control room and was confronted by a large pile cut into multitrack tapes. They told superior that they had reconsidered tawdry concept for the album range I had presented to them in January and had confident to let me go developed and mix and put deputize together from all the cut that we had done destiny Savile Row. I was charmed at the idea and spontaneously when they would be nourish to start. They replied ramble they were quite happy safe me to do it swot up on my own as it was my idea. I left soft spot elated that they would commend me to put the single together without them, but before you know it realized that the real coherent had to be that they had lost interest in honesty project.

Glyn Johns – From “Sound Man: A Life Recording Hits with The Rolling Stones, Position Who, Led Zeppelin, the Eagles , Eric Clapton, the Faces…”, 2014

The extraordinary thing progression that [The Beatles] proved limitation to that point that they were the masters of influence “Produced Record”, yet the matter I did with them wasn’t “produced” in that way survey all, it was all taped live in a room, just the thing a rehearsal situation. And mind that, I think it has great value, because I at first put together an album recognize rehearsals, with chat and funniness and bits of general chat in between the tracks, which was the way I desired [‘Get Back’] to be – breakdowns, false starts.

Really, loftiness idea was that at glory time, they were viewed in that being the be-all-and-end-all, sort systematic up on a pedestal, outwith touch, just gods, completely veranda gallery, and what I witnessed set up on at these rehearsals was that, in fact, they were hysterically funny, but very weird and wonderful people in many ways. Abstruse they were capable of completion as a band, which one and all was beginning to wonder underrate at that point, because they hadn’t done so for dried up time – everything had back number prepared in advance, everything challenging been overdubbed and everything. Existing they proved in that exercise that they could still acceptance and play at the exact same time, and they could cloudless records without all those odd and wonderful sounds on them.

I got the bit between cutback teeth about it, and get someone on the blower night, I mixed a crew of stuff that they didn’t even know I’d recorded divided the time – I steady whacked the recorder on verify a lot of stuff turn this way they did, and gave them an acetate the following dawning of what I’d done, despite the fact that a rough idea of what an album could be choose, released as it was. Encircling was one thing that happened once, a song wander Paul played to the residuum, which I believe he subsequent used on one of culminate ensuing albums, called “Teddy Boy”, and I have a strip of Paul actually teaching class others this song. I esteemed it, and I was aspiring they’d finish it and unwrap it, because I thought in the chips was really good. But capsize version does go on unmixed bit, and they’re just revive round and round, trying show accidentally get the chord sequence bring forth, I suppose, and the superlative bit is where John Songster gets bored – he certainly doesn’t want to play drench anymore, and starts doing ruler interjections. They came back spell said they didn’t like consist of, or each individual bloke came in and said he didn’t like it, and that was the end of that.

Glyn Artist – From “And In Say publicly End” by Ken McNab

Glyn Johns participated in the initial sessions backing Wings’ album, Red Rose Speedway, recorded in 1972; but nautical port after a few weeks. Mid the reasons, the fact lapse everyone in the studio praise smoke pot, or simply wind Paul in reality didn’t long for to be bothered by grand producer.

One evening they (Seiwell status Laine – author’s note) articulated, “We’re not happy with spiky as a producer. You’re yell taking any interest in what we are doing”. I held, “If you think that cosmos you do is a curio of marvelous music, you’re improper. And if you want chance sit and play shit take up get stoned for a rare hours […] don’t expect sap to record everything you’re observation, because frankly it’s a function of tape and it’s boss waste of my energy.

Glyn Artist, in FAB, an Intimate Convinced of Paul McCartney

He and Unpleasant didn’t hit it off undergo all. Paul always likes to well his own producer anyway, on the contrary at least if he’s leaden to bring one in they’ve got to be able give explanation see Paul’s point of view.

Denny Laine, in Blackbird: The Life forward Times of Paul McCartney

The allocate after I finished with Position Eagles, I went straight absorb with Paul McCartney and Utmost to cut the Red Rosebush Speedway album, which I take home in a puff of smog after a couple of weeks, and then went straight culpability to work with Ronnie Thoroughfare up one`s and Ronnie Wood on ethics soundtrack to the movie Mahoney’s Estate, with our friend, description actor and director Alexis Kanner.

Glyn Johns, in SOUND MAN, 2014
